Now, let's talk about where to find these codes. There are a few reliable spots to look, kind of like having a well-organized toolbox.
First, check the retailer's official website or newsletter. They often announce special promotions there.
Second, look for coupon aggregator sites. These sites collect codes from various sources, but be sure to verify them before use.
Third, consider signing up for loyalty programs. Many companies offer exclusive discounts to their members.
Fourth, don't overlook social media. Retailers sometimes share promo codes on their social channels.
And fifth, keep an eye out for seasonal sales and holiday promotions. These often come with extra savings opportunities.
As you're searching, be aware that not all codes are created equal. Some might only apply to certain categories or have expiration dates. It's like sorting through a pile of screws—some will fit your needs, others won't.
Also, watch out for codes that seem too good to be true. If a discount sounds unrealistic, it probably is. Stick to reputable sources to avoid any potential issues.

Common Mistakes
Now, let's talk about some common mistakes to avoid when using promo codes.
First, don't wait until the last minute to look for codes. You might miss out on a great deal if you're not proactive.
Second, don't assume a code will work without verifying it. Always double-check before you get too far into the checkout process.
Third, don't forget to read the terms and conditions. Some codes have specific requirements or restrictions that you need to be aware of.
Fourth, don't overlook the possibility of combining codes. Sometimes you can stack discounts for even bigger savings.
And fifth, don't get discouraged if a code doesn't work. There are plenty of other opportunities out there.
Tips and Tricks
Here are a few additional tips to help you make the most of promo codes:
- Use browser extensions that automatically apply codes at checkout.
- Set up alerts for your favorite retailers so you never miss a sale.
- Follow retailers on social media for exclusive offers.
- Consider using a separate email address for coupon subscriptions to keep your inbox organized.
- Always make a copy of the promo code before applying it, just in case you need to re-enter it.
FAQs
What if a promo code doesn't work?
If a promo code doesn't work, double-check that it's still valid and applicable to your purchase. If it still doesn't work, try another code or contact customer support for assistance.
Can I use multiple promo codes at once?
It depends on the retailer. Some allow stacking codes for additional savings, while others only accept one code per purchase. Always check the terms and conditions.
